Buffer blaze query
It was previously sending each label individually over gRPC, where each call has a lot of overhead. This makes queries with a large amount of output _a lot_ faster. For an example query where all packages are already loaded, I observe a difference of ~3.5s before this change to ~1.6s after this change. PiperOrigin-RevId: 177426957
